Position: Vice President, Wealth Management (Confidential)

The Vice President, Wealth Management will lead the advisory team, product evolution, and digital modernization. This executive oversees nationwide distribution of a multidisciplinary range of financial services including insurance, investments, financial planning, credit counselling and financial literacy. The role involves setting strategy, driving growth and managing transformational change through innovation.

QUALIFICATIONS
  • Master’s or Bachelor’s degree in business administration, commerce or a related field.
  • Minimum of 15+ years of experience in wealth management, with a proven track record in leadership, business development and goal achievement.
  • 15+ years of experience in insurance in a financial services environment
R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Develop and execute strategic plan, ensuring alignment with organizational strategy and measures
  • Lead the advisory sales team, set and achieve revenue targets and KPIs.
  • Drive sustainable business growth through coaching, innovative sales and marketing strategies.
  • Collaborate on the management of wealth products and services, recommending changes to offerings based on market trends and client needs.
  • Direct the delivery of wealth management services and practice standards.
  • Manage budgets, authorize financial transactions, and ensure financial oversight and compliance with regulatory requirements.
  • Lead organizational change initiatives to support modernization of advisory practices, including digital modernization and solutions, adoption of emerging technologies (such as AI), practice standards and omni-channel delivery.
  • Ongoing process improvement and solutioning to enhance client and employee experiences.
  • Set standards for advisory training and development, fostering high-performance coaching and talent growth to achieve targeted client experience goals.
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ant policies, procedures, regulations, and legislation, including CIRO, provincial insurance, privacy, and evolving industry requirements.
  • Provide strategic advice to executives and senior stakeholders on wealth management, corporate risk, client financial wellness, and market positioning.
  • Build and manage strategic partnerships with stakeholders, external business partners, and regulators.
  • Leverage business intelligence, analytics, and key performance indicators to inform decision-making, track results, and direct corrective actions to achieve business and financial targets.
